absolute poverty
|
situation of being unable to meet minimum levels of income, clothing, food, healthcare, shelter
|
|
subsistence economy
|
an economy in which production is mainly for personal consumption- basic life necesities
|
|
development
|
process of improving quality of peoples lives by raising peoples levels of living, self-esteem, and freedom
|
|
traditional econ
|
approach emphasizing utility, profit maximization, market efficiency, and finding equil.
|
|
political econ
|
attempt to merge econ analysis and practical politics
|
|
globalization
|
increasing integration of national econs into expanding international markets
|
|
social system
|
organization and institutional structure of society including values, attitudes, power structure and traditions
|
|
income per capita
|
total gross national income divided by pop.
|
|
gross national income GNI
|
total domestic and foreign output claimed by residents of a country. includes GDP plus income from residents abroad minus foreigners earning domestically
|
|
gross domestic product GDP
|
total financial outputs of goods and services produced by the country's econ within the country by residents and foreigners, regardless of domestic and foreign claims
|
|
sustenance
|
basic goods and services- food, clothing, shelter- necessary for life
|
|
millennium development goals MDG
|
set of 8 goals adopted by UN in 2000 to eradicate extreme poverty, achieve universal education, equality, reduce HIV rates, reduce disease, improve maternal health
